Peak Flow Monitoring allows objective tracking of lung function at home, providing early warning of worsening asthma and guiding treatment decisions.

Record readings twice daily for 2-3 weeks when asthma is well-controlled. Highest reading during this period is your personal best.
Patients with moderate-severe asthma benefit from daily monitoring during instability. Once stable, reduce to twice weekly. Increase frequency when worsening.
